1. Ingredient seasonality
Ingredient seasonality significantly impacts the planning and execution of a “Halloween dinner 2022 recipes.” The availability of certain produce, such as pumpkins, squash, apples, and root vegetables, peaks during the autumn months, the season in which Halloween occurs. This seasonality directly influences recipe selection, favoring dishes that incorporate these ingredients. Using in-season produce enhances flavor, reduces cost compared to out-of-season options, and supports local agriculture. A menu featuring roasted butternut squash soup, apple pie, or pumpkin risotto exemplifies the integration of seasonal ingredients into a Halloween dinner.
The practical application of this understanding involves careful menu planning. Considering regional variations in harvest times allows for optimal sourcing of ingredients. For instance, individuals residing in warmer climates might find different varieties of squash readily available compared to those in colder regions. Adapting recipes to utilize the freshest, locally sourced ingredients not only improves the quality of the meal but also reduces the environmental impact associated with long-distance transportation of produce. Additionally, employing preservation techniques such as canning or freezing can extend the availability of seasonal ingredients beyond their peak.

The practical application of thematic decoration extends beyond merely placing spooky ornaments on the table. It involves considering color palettes, lighting, and the arrangement of food itself. Employing colors such as black, orange, purple, and green can reinforce the Halloween theme. Using strategically placed candles or dim lighting can create a more eerie and dramatic atmosphere. The arrangement of dishes, utilizing serving platters and decorative garnishes, further enhances the visual appeal. For instance, a “graveyard” dessert, constructed with crumbled chocolate cookies as “dirt” and gummy worms as “worms,” demonstrates a deliberate effort to integrate thematic elements into the presentation.

The practical application of dietary adaptations within the context of a Halloween dinner involves several key steps. Initially, it requires proactive communication with guests to ascertain any specific dietary needs. This can be achieved through invitations that include a section for noting allergies or preferences. Subsequently, menu planning must prioritize adaptable recipes that can be easily modified to exclude common allergens such as gluten, dairy, nuts, or soy. For example, a traditional pumpkin pie could be adapted using a gluten-free crust and dairy-free filling. Furthermore, clearly labeling dishes with their ingredients can help guests make informed choices. Providing alternative options, such as vegan or vegetarian dishes, ensures that all attendees have suitable selections. Menu Planning and Task Prioritization
Menu planning is the initial step in effective time management. It involves selecting recipes that align with the available time and skill level. Task prioritization entails identifying the most time-consuming elements of the meal, such as braising meats or preparing elaborate desserts, and allocating sufficient time for their completion. For example, preparing a slow-cooked stew the day before or assembling complex decorations in advance can significantly reduce time pressure on the day of the dinner. This ensures that the most critical components receive adequate attention, minimizing the risk of last-minute compromises.
-
Ingredient Preparation and Mise en Place
Efficient ingredient preparation is paramount for streamlining the cooking process. This includes washing, chopping, and measuring all ingredients before beginning to cook. The French culinary term “mise en place,” meaning “everything in its place,” encapsulates this principle. By having all ingredients readily available, the cook can focus on the cooking process itself, reducing delays and errors. For example, pre-chopping vegetables for a pumpkin soup or measuring spices for a spice cake simplifies the cooking process and minimizes the potential for oversight.
-
Cooking Schedule and Timeline Adherence
Developing a detailed cooking schedule and adhering to a strict timeline is essential for coordinating multiple dishes. This involves calculating the cooking time for each recipe, taking into account resting periods and potential delays. A well-defined timeline ensures that all dishes are ready simultaneously, preventing some items from becoming cold while others are still being prepared. For example, scheduling the dessert to be finished just before the main course is completed allows for efficient use of oven space and ensures that each course is served at the optimal temperature.
-
Buffer Time and Contingency Planning
Allocating buffer time for unexpected delays is a crucial aspect of effective time management. This involves adding extra time to each task to account for potential problems, such as equipment malfunctions or ingredient shortages. Contingency planning involves identifying alternative solutions for potential setbacks. For example, having a backup recipe for a dish that proves to be problematic or having readily available ingredients for a simpler alternative ensures that the dinner can proceed smoothly, even in the face of unexpected challenges.

Color Palette Selection
The deliberate use of color palettes directly influences the visual impact of the Halloween dinner. Traditional Halloween colors such as black, orange, and deep purples can be incorporated into both the food itself and the surrounding decorations. For instance, utilizing black food coloring for pasta or creating orange-colored sauces from butternut squash contributes to the thematic consistency. Contrast plays a vital role; strategically juxtaposing light and dark elements can enhance visual interest and create a more dynamic presentation. The choice of color has a direct effect on appetite and perceived quality, making it a key factor in the overall aesthetic.
-
Thematic Plating Techniques
The manner in which food is arranged on the plate significantly impacts the dining experience. Thematic plating techniques involve arranging elements to evoke the Halloween theme. Examples include using cookie cutters to shape food into bats or ghosts, creating edible spiderwebs with chocolate sauce, or presenting dishes in miniature cauldrons or pumpkin shells. Utilizing height and texture variations adds visual depth and complexity. Strategic placement of garnishes, such as edible flowers or herbs, can further enhance the aesthetic appeal. These techniques serve to transform ordinary dishes into thematic works of art, contributing to the overall immersive experience of the Halloween dinner.
-
Table Setting and Ambiance
The overall table setting and ambiance form an integral part of presentation aesthetics. Elements such as tablecloths, napkins, centerpieces, and lighting contribute to the overall atmosphere. Utilizing black or orange tablecloths, incorporating spooky-themed centerpieces like miniature skeletons or faux cobwebs, and employing dim or colored lighting can enhance the Halloween mood. The arrangement of cutlery and glassware, along with the use of thematic serving dishes, further contributes to the visual harmony of the table.
